In industrial production, temperature is one of the important parameters need to measure and control. Widely used in the temperature measurement, thermocouple, it has a simple structure, easy fabrication, wide measuring range, high precision, inertia small, easy in output signal transmission. In addition, since the k type thermocouple is active sensors, so there is no need to measure the external power supply. It is very convenient to use, so usually used to measure the temperature of the furnace gas or liquid, the surface temperature of the tube and solid. First of all, the response time of the thermocouple to the structure and size. That is to say, the thicker the hot electrode and the diameter of the protecting tube, tube wall is thick, the greater the inertia, so the stability of thermocouple, the longer the greater its effect on response time. Second, thermocouple response time also changes according to the working state, that is to say, the same structure of the thermocouple, under the condition of different heat exchange, response time is different. Third, the thermocouple made of different materials with different thermal conductivity. Metal protection tube, for example, has better than ceramic protection tube of the thermal conductivity, thermal inertia is small, therefore, thermocouple stable in a short period of time, the response time is short.
